    General Information

    Low evergreen shrub, usually not over ca. 2 m tall, generally from an underground woody burl, with gray, longitudinally furrowed bark; twigs slightly angled, usually stout, sparsely to moderately lepidote, otherwise glabrous; buds ovoid, 2-4 × 23 mm. Leaf blades ovate, 2-6(-9) × 1.7-5(-6.7) cm, ± flat, thick-coriaceous, ca. 0.4-0.7 mm thick; base cordate to less commonly rounded (to cuneate in immature plants); apex slightly acuminate or acute, to truncate or rounded; margin revolute or plane, apical portion irregularly sinuous to obscurely toothed, basal portion sinuous to entire; venation brochidodromous, 3° veins reticulate to percurrent; adaxial surface often roughened by thickened scale bases, especially near margin or toward apex, lepidote but scales usually quickly deciduous, glabrous on midvein, the veins usually slightly depressed, ± obscure above 4°; abaxial surface moderately to densely lepidote, otherwise densely pubescent, all veins prominently raised and forming conspicuous network; scales rust colored, deciduous to persistent, ca. 0.07-0.22 mm in diameter, erose to nearly entire; petiole 4-10 mm long, lepidote, otherwise glabrous; flower buds ± intermixed with vegetative buds. Inflorescences fasciculate to shortly racemose, 4-13-flowered; pedicels clearly articulated with calyx, stout, 5-20 mm long, lepidote, otherwise pubescent; bracteoles opposite to subopposite, basal or nearly so, narrowly triangular, 2-6 nun long; floral bracts 4-9 mm long, usually caducous. Flowers (5-)6-7(-8)-merous; calyx lobes triangular, with acuminate apices, (2-)2.5-6 × 1.5-5 mm, adaxial side slightly pubescent, especially at margins and near apex, abaxial side densely lepidote, otherwise moderately to densely pubescent; corolla carnose, urceolate, white to pink tinged, especially near mouth, 8-13 × 8-13 mm, abaxially densely to moderately lepidote; filaments roughened, 4.5-7 mm long, unappendaged or with spurs to ca. 0.6 mm long near junction with anthers; anthers 2-4 mm long; ovary lepidote, otherwise pubescent, placentae subapical to nearly central. Capsules subglobose to short-ovoid, 4-7 × 7-10.5 mm, moderately to densely lepidote, otherwise sparsely to densely pubescent, especially near base, the pale, very thick sutures separating as unit from adjacent valves; seeds 1.5-2 mm long.
